Understanding Online Casino Licensing and Regulation

One of the most critical aspects of choosing a reputable online casino is verifying its licensing and regulatory status. A valid license signifies that the casino has met specific standards of operation, including fairness, security, and financial stability. Licensing jurisdictions,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, and the Kahnawake Gaming Commission, are known for their rigorous oversight. Players should always look for casinos that display their licensing information prominently on their website. Ignoring this step can expose individuals to potentially fraudulent or unreliable platforms. A casino operating without a valid license may lack the necessary safeguards for player protection, potentially leading to unfair game outcomes or difficulties with withdrawals.

The Importance of Third-Party Audits

Beyond licensing, credible online casinos undergo regular audits by independent third-party organizations. These audits examine the casino's random number generators (RNGs) to ensure the fairness of game results. Organizations like eCOGRA and iTech Labs are well-respected in the industry and provide impartial assessments of casino software and payout percentages. A positive audit report demonstrates a commitment to transparency and player trust. It’s also important to understand that the location of the licensing jurisdiction can impact the level of player protection afforded. Some jurisdictions have more stringent requirements than others regarding responsible gambling measures and dispute resolution procedures.

Licensing Jurisdiction Reputation Key Features
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) Excellent Strong regulatory framework, player protection focus
U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) Excellent Very high standards, comprehensive regulations
Kahnawake Gaming Commission (KGC) Good Long-standing regulator, particularly for sports betting
Curacao eGaming Moderate Less stringent, but still provides a level of oversight

Understanding these differing levels of regulation empowers players to make informed decisions about where they choose to spend their time and money. Always prioritize casinos with strong licensing and a history of positive audit results.

Exploring Bonus Structures and Wagering Requirements

Online casinos frequently offer a variety of b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can enhance the gaming experience, it’s cr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ions, particularly wagering requirements. Wagering requirements dictate the amount of money a player must bet before they can withdraw any winnings derived from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means the player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before being eligible for a payout. Failing to meet these requirements can result in forfeited bonuses and winnings. Players should carefully evaluate the wagering requirements alongside the bonus amount to determine its true value.

Decoding the Fine Print of Casino Promotions

Beyond wagering requirements, other important factors to consider include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and time constraints. Some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may impose limits on the maximum amount a player can bet per spin or hand. Additionally, bonuses typically have an expiration date, after which they become void. It's essential to read the terms and conditions thoroughly before claiming any bonus to avoid any unpleasant surprises. A reputable casino will clearly outline all the relevant details of its promotions in a transparent and easy-to-understand manner.

  • Welcome Bonuses: Typically offered to new players upon registration.
  • Deposit Matches: The casino matches a percentage of the player's initial deposit.
  • Free Spins: Allow players to spin the reels of specific slot games without wagering their own money.
  • Loyalty Programs: Reward players for their continued patronage with points, perks, and exclusive bonuses.
  • No-Deposit Bonuses: Less common, but offer a small amount of credit without requiring a deposit.

Understanding these different bonus types and their associated conditions is key to maximizing your online casino experience. Don’t be afraid to contact customer support if you have any questions about a specific promotion.

The Importance of Secure Payment Methods and Data Protection

When engaging in online gambling, ensuring the security of your financial transactions and personal data is paramount. Reputable online casinos employ advanced enc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ption, to protect sensitive information from unauthorized access. They also partner with trusted payment processors who adhere to strict security standards. Common payment methods include cred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), and bank transfers. Players should avoid casinos that offer limited or questionable payment options. A wide variety of secure and convenient payment methods is a positive sign of a trustworthy platform. Furthermore, it is crucial to verify that the casino has a robust privacy policy in place, outlining how your personal data will be collected, used, and protected.

Two-Factor Authentication and Responsible Gaming Features

Enhancing your account security can be done by enabling two-factor authentication (2FA). 2FA adds an extra layer of protection by requiring a code from your mobile device in addition to your password. This makes it significantly more difficult for unauthorized individuals to access your account, even if they obtain your password. Reputable casinos are also increasingly implementing responsible gaming features, such as de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ks. These tools empower players to manage their gambling habits and prevent potential problems. A commitment to responsible gaming demonstrates a casino's ethical approach and concern for player well-being.

  1. Set Deposit Limits: Control the amount of money you deposit into your account.
  2. Set Loss Limits: Limit the amount of money you are willing to lose.
  3. Utilize Self-Exclusion: Temporarily or permanently block access to your account.
  4. Take Regular Breaks: Avoid prolonged gaming sessions.
  5. Seek Help if Needed: Numerous resources are available for problem gamblers.

Prioritizing security and responsible gaming practices is essential for a safe and enjoyable online casino experience.

Navigating Game Selection and Software Providers

The diversity of game selection is a key factor in attracting and retaining players at online casinos. A comprehensive casino will offer a wide range of games, including slots, table games (such as blackjack, roulette, and baccarat), video poker, and live dealer games. The quality of these games is largely determined by the software providers that power the casino. Leading software providers, such as Microgaming, NetEnt, Playtech, and Evolution Gaming, are renowned for their innovative game designs, high-quality graphics, and fair gameplay. Casinos that partner with these reputable providers are more likely to offer a superior gaming experience. It is also important to consider the availability of mobile-friendly games, as many players prefer to gamble on the go.
